I have an unused temporary entry work visa which will expire next month. This entry visa has not been stamped in my passport and I have not entered Qatar.  Can a new company/sponsor apply a new temporary entry work visa for me once the previously issued entry visa expires? 
I appreciate your advise on this.

Officially If the New/Temporary Visa Expired without Entry to Qatar it wont cause any problem . Your visa will be voided or cancelled automatically if there was no port of expat entry.
